    Title: MEDICAL READINESS AND DEPLOYMENT TRAINING SPECIALIST COMPANY: Air Force Materiel Command COMPANY NAICS: Location ZipCode: 45433 Job Description: * DutiesHelp## Duties### SummaryClick on "Learn more about this agency" button below to view Eligibilitiesbeing considered and other IMPORTANT information.The primary purpose of this position is to serve as a Medical Readiness and Deployment Training Specialist. Maintains overall unit medical readiness and deployment training as outlined in DOC statement for deployment as directed by higher headquarters.
